A graduate has the required knowledge to fully develop (design, install, maintain and support) IT and telecommunications systems. The curriculum of studies is designed to meet the needs of today's market, and also enable graduates to cope the best possible wayand to have the flexibility to face new challenges within the rapidly evolving information and telecommunication technology. They can active be professionally inthe field of software and anything that is related to:
• analyzing the IT needs of a company (or organization)
• developing reliable software
• installing software on computer systems
• softwaremaintenance
• the preparation of specifications and small scale IT systems and the development of such systems
• applying technical quality control and security of Information Systems
• assessing the effectiveness and cost of software development.
Graduates may be employedin the public and private sector, however they can create their own development and software maintenance business. In the Telecommunications industry they may be employed as:
• analysts and designers of telecommunication systems and networks
• engineers in the telecommunications industry regarding issues covering analogue transmission and digital signals via electrical or optical channels.
The graduate is also familiar with telecommunications regulations and standards, as well as design and software for telecommunications systems. Graduates are prepared for direct recruitment by companies that use public and private telecommunications systems or sell products or services for telecommunications functions. In the field of Multimedia they may be employed as:
• developers of software applications and multimedia management information e.g. image , audio , video, interactive communication
• Multimedia experts
Graduates may also be employed in jobs that deal with specific developmentrelated applications in the private and public sector, in companies producing telecommunication applications, service companies and online advertising companies. A graduate may also be employed by TEI as a Laboratory Associate or Technical Staff, as well as in the IEK and Secondary Education as a science teacher. Furthermore, there are graduates working as team members in research laboratories, as well as others that attend or have attended courses towards an M.Sc. or doctoral degree atUniversities in Greece or abroad.
